The hospital I attend, in the UK, recommends Efudix 1 / day for 4 to 6 weeks.

Every other hospital in the UK seems to recommend 2 / day.

I'm on day 23 on my forehead and it has a lot of blotches a bit like aceace.

Despite what others are saying I'll do my face a bit at a time. My dermotologist seems quite laid back about time and has frozen off the bigger AK.

I've thought about the possibility of going through the treatment 'piece by piece', keeping in mind I had an allergic reaction to Carac, so my reaction was anything but normal. However, I understand that even a normal reaction is very painful. Over all, I think I'd rather endure the discomfort all over and then be done with it. Yes, I dreamed of sleeping through the night, but now that it is over I'm glad I don't have to think of it anymore. Looking back, I'd ask if I could apply Aqualphor two hours after applying Carac...I'm certain that would help. And, since neither Benedryl nor TylenolPM helped me, I'd ask for an RX for a sleep aid. Sleep is sooo important when you're going through this level of pain. I'll think of you. Be brave. Lousy

 I am 43 and went through a 4 week application of effudex this past January.  For me, it was not nearly as bad as the online pictures.  Sure, I was red and sore, especially around the nose and ears, but compared to the alternative, it was hopefully worth it.  I did not get completely red or pussy like some online pictures that are out there.  It was unsightly, and I was blotchy for about a week or so after the last application.  I am still convinced that it was all worth it.  Skin cancer is nothing to take lightly!  Bite the bullet and do what is best for your skin in the long run.

Dear Friends, I have finished my 16 day treatment 2x a day to the face. I am really red, blotchy, a bit peely and pins/needles pain. I was happy to be finished but just read about additional pain and peeling after stopping treatment. Did you all "face" that? One tip to new readers: it seems the pain is worst 5 hours after application. I found that soaking my face in a warm bath stopped the pain. Also, one night I put a hot blowdryer to may face......I KNOW but it stopped the pain!!!!!
